Output 99c141da5950ee61906a45693f861b352a38fd4393fac9662a00d3b0f43af841:3

value
42033291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2df20369bf9c0ed4f60ade0c13d0a4e54f777b16 OP_EQUAL
address
MC66ZSgoFnhjsYLdQwFFAG2DW7nbNzb62v
transaction
99c141da5950ee61906a45693f861b352a38fd4393fac9662a00d3b0f43af841
spent
true